总之,Caffeine是一个功能强大且灵活的本地缓存工具,它通过提供自动加载、异步刷新、失效策略、缓存访问统计、过期机制和删除提醒等特性,帮助我们更好地管理和利用缓存。通过合理配置Caffeine的过期策略、剔除机制...
总之,Caffeine是一个功能强大且灵活的本地缓存工具,它通过提供自动加载、异步刷新、失效策略、缓存访问统计、过期机制和删除提醒等特性,帮助我们更好地管理和利用缓存。通过合理配置Caffeine的过期策略、剔除机制...
Spring Boot提供了多个缓存实现,包括ConcurrentMapCacheManager、EhCacheCacheManager、RedisCacheManager、CaffeineCacheManager等。缓存可以在应用程序中使用,以提高应用程序的性能和响应速度。缓存工作原理很...
一、JSR107规范 Java Caching定义了5个...CachingProvider定义了创建、配置、获取、管理和控制多个CacheManager。一个应用可以在运行期访问多个CachingProvider。 CacheManager定义了创建、配置、获取、管理和控制...
标题:Spring框架中的缓存管理详解摘要:本文将介绍Spring框架中的缓存管理,探讨如何使用Spring提供的缓存注解和配置来提升应用的性能。通过详细说明缓存的概念、应用场景以及示例代码,帮助读者理解和使用Spring中...
Jmeter之缓存管理器
Spring Boot 实践之九 Spring Boot 缓存管理 缓存是分布式系统中的重要组件,主要解决数据库数据的高并发访问。在实际开发中,尤其是用户访问量较大的网站,用户对高频热点数据的访问非常频繁,为了提高服务器...
文章目录Shiro缓存管理 Shiro缓存管理 用于缓存角色数据和权限数据,每次不用都从数据库中获取数据,直接从缓存中获取 redis缓存操作 package com.shiro.cache; import com.shiro.util.JedisUtil; import org....
SpringBoot的默认缓存,基于注解的Redis缓存实现以及基于API的Redis缓存实现,还有解决乱码的配置类
在我们接触的缓存大致两种,本地缓存与中间件缓存。我们使用缓存大多数是通过api的方式来操作,厉害的人也可以自己自定义注解来简化操作,但是看完这篇博客,以后操作注解就不会辣么麻烦了。 当我们操作cahche...
从15年3月接触Ceph分布式存储系统,至今已经5年了;因为工作的需要,对Ceph的主要模块进行了较深入的学习,也...这是第四篇:Ceph bluestore中的缓存管理 前言 bluestore构建在裸盘上,在用户空间,通过FreelistMana...
缓存管理器 Windows 的缓存管理器是一组内核模式的函数和系统例程,为所有的Windows文件系统驱动程序提供了系统缓存的能力。 Windows 缓存管理器按照虚拟地址为基础来缓存数据,它被赋予系统虚拟地址空间中的...
`SpringCache`框架还提供了`CacheManager`接口,可以实现降低对各种缓存框架的耦合。它不是具体的缓存实现,它只提供一整套的接口和代码规范、配置、注解等,用于整合各种缓存方案,比如`Caffeine`、`Guava Cache`、...
前言众所周知,HDFS作为一个分布式文件系统.存储着海量的数据,每天的IO读写操作次数当然是非常高的.所以在之前的文章中,我们提到了用HDFS的异构存储来做冷热数据的分类存储,但比较好的一点是,他们还是隶属于同一个...
HTTP授权管理器 HTTP授权管理器使可以为使用服务器身份验证限制的网页指定一个或多个用户登录名。当使用浏览器访问受限页面时,可以看到这种身份验证,并且浏览器将显示一个登录对话框。当遇到此类页面时,JMeter可...
4. Simple缓存组件是Spring Boot默认的缓存管理组件,它默认使用内存中的(ConcurrentHashMap)进行缓存存储。3.下列关于Spring Boot中RedisTemplate进行数据缓存管理的说法,正确的是(ACD)。5.下列关于将Spring ...
Spring支持“透明”地向应用程序添加缓存,将缓存应用于方法,在方法执行前检查缓存中是否有可用的数据。这样可以减少方法执行的次数,同时提高响应的速度。缓存的应用方式“透明”,不会对调用者造成任何干扰。只要...
缓存的作用 mybatis缓存机制用于提高数据库性能,减轻数据压力。 缓存作用域 一级缓存是sqlsession级别的,就是每个sqlsession里都有一个HashMap来存储数据,当然不同对象每个缓存区域也不一样,所以一级缓存是不...
文章目录前言使用说明系统主界面ArcGIS缓存切片生成步骤设置服务初始化生成切片更新缓存切片文件系统注册系统版本下载地址系统支持 前言 通过ArcGIS平台进行地理信息系统开发的人员经常要进行网页系统的开发,...
缓存适用环境? 1. 提供网络服务的应用 2. 数据更新不需要实时更新。 3. 缓存的过期时间是可以接受的。 带来的好处? 1. 服务器的压力大大减小 2. 客户端的响应速度大大变快(用户体验) 3. 客户端的数据...
HDFS缓存管理操作实战 Debugo 2014-12-21 232 阅读 Hadoop HDFS System HDFS提供了一个高效的缓存加速机制——Centralized Cache Management,可以将一些经常被读取的文件(例如Hive中的fact表)pin到内存...
1.HDFS集中化缓存管理具有哪些优势? 2.HDFS中的集中化缓存管理有哪些使用场景? 3.缓存管理有哪些命令? 概述 HDFS中的集中化缓存管理是一个明确的缓存机制,它允许用户指定要缓存的HDFS路径。NameNode会...
Spring缓存管理的实现可以分为两个部分来讲: 借力AOP:如何通过AOP使缓存管理生效; 缓存管理:缓存管理的本质是什么; 一.借力AOP 1.织入代理对象 为了在业务代码中使用Spring缓存管理,也需要在Bean中织入...
1. 缓存相关概念 缓存 : 凡是位于速度相差较大的两种硬件之间,用于协调两者数据传输速度差异的结构,均可称之为缓存(Cache)。 因为内存相对于硬盘读写速度更快,内存可以作为硬盘的缓存;同样的,硬盘读写速度远...
每个虚拟用户线程都有自己的缓存。默认情况下,Cache Manager将使用LRU算法在虚拟用户线程的高速缓存中存储多达5000个项目。...请注意,增加此值越多,HTTP缓存管理器将消耗内存,因此请务必相应地调整-Xm...
HDFS允许用户将一部分目录或文件缓存在 of-heap 内存中,以加速对这些数据的访问效率,该机制被称为集中式缓存管理。 集中式缓存管理的好处体现在哪? 提高集群的内存利用率。当使用操作系统的缓存时,对一个数据...
一级缓存的生命周期和SqlSession的生命周期相同 二级缓存和整个应用的生命周期相同 一级缓存存放的结果不是查询出的结果本身,而是一个Map【无法关闭 //一级缓存中底层实现是一个Map //key:statementId和sql语句 //...
如何实现前端缓存管理?